Fonteyn is a very soft lilac tinted holographic silver hue with a fabulous scattered but dense chromatic display. The formula is superb, opaque on one coat - rich but very easy to apply and self levelling. It can easily be a one coater. Glossy finish and perfect with or without top coat. Shown in two light coats with no top coat.

Her Rose Adagio is a gentle pink with even scattered but vivid holographic hue. Fantastic flow and slightly lighter formula than
Fonteyn but it can still be a one coater. It was very easy to apply and self-levelling. Glossy smooth finish which make them gorgeous with or without top coat. Shown in two light coats with no top coat.

Encore Margot a very pale-blue toned silver holographic hue with gorgeous scattered, but linear, prismatic effect. Great formula, the consistency was good, very similar to
Her Rose Adagio. Again Glossy finish, very easy to apply and also self levelling, and just like
Fonteyn - it was opaque on one coat. Shown in two light coats with no top coat.
